Broccoli Cheese Stuffed Baked Potatoes – Easy Vegetarian Dinner

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r Email
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

These Broccoli Cheese Stuffed Baked Potatoes are the ultimate comfort food—crispy on the outside, fluffy on the inside, and smothered in a rich, creamy cheddar cheese sauce packed with tender broccoli florets.

It’s the kind of cozy, satisfying meal that feels indulgent but comes together with just a few wholesome ingredients.

Perfect for a quick vegetarian dinner, a hearty lunch, or a side dish that steals the spotlight, this stuffed baked potato recipe will become your new go-to whenever you’re craving something warm, cheesy, and comforting.

What You’ll Need (Ingredient Highlights)

Russet potatoes – High-starch potatoes with crispy skin and fluffy interior

Olive oil + kosher salt – For seasoning and crisping the skins

Cheddar cheese – Freshly grated for the smoothest melt

Butter + flour + milk – For a creamy homemade cheese sauce base

Broccoli florets – Finely chopped for easy stirring and even bites

Cayenne and garlic powder – Just a hint of spice and warmth

Chives or scallions – Optional garnish for a fresh finish

Black pepper – For seasoning to taste

Pro Tips Before You Start

Use russet potatoes – They bake up fluffy and hold their shape well

Grate your own cheese – Pre-shredded cheese can make the sauce grainy

Chop broccoli finely – So it softens quickly in the sauce

Don’t skip poking the potatoes – It prevents them from bursting in the oven

Bake directly on the rack (optional) – For extra crisp skins

How to Make Broccoli Cheese Stuffed Baked Potatoes

Step 1: Bake the Potatoes

Preheat your oven to 425°F (218°C).

Wash and scrub 2 large russet potatoes, then poke each a few times with a fork.

Rub with olive oil and sprinkle with kosher salt.

Place directly on a sheet pan and bake for 50–60 minutes, or until fork-tender and slightly puffed.

Let cool for 5 minutes before handling.

Step 2: Make the Broccoli Cheese Sauce

Start this step during the final 5–10 minutes of baking time.

In a small saucepan, melt 2 Tbsp unsalted butter over medium heat.

Whisk in 2 Tbsp all-purpose flour and cook for about 1 minute.

Gradually whisk in 1 cup milk until smooth.

Stir in ¼ tsp cayenne, ⅛–¼ tsp garlic powder, and ⅛–¼ tsp salt.

Bring to a gentle simmer, stirring until slightly thickened.

Lower heat and slowly add 5.5 oz freshly grated cheddar cheese, one handful at a time, whisking until fully melted.

Stir in 2 cups finely chopped broccoli florets, then remove from heat.

Step 3: Stuff and Serve

Slice each baked potato lengthwise and gently fluff the inside with a fork.

Season with black pepper and chopped chives or scallions, if desired.

Pour the warm broccoli cheese sauce over each potato generously.

Serve immediately while hot and melty.

Variations & Substitutions

Add bacon bits or crumbled tempeh – For extra flavor and crunch

Swap in cauliflower – For a twist on the broccoli

Use different cheeses – Try smoked gouda, pepper jack, or fontina

Make it spicy – Add jalapeños or hot sauce to the cheese sauce

Turn it into a casserole – Scoop out potato flesh, mix with sauce, restuff, and bake

Storage & Reheating Tips

Fridge – Store stuffed potatoes in an airtight container up to 3 days

Reheat – Microwave or warm in the oven at 350°F until heated through

Make ahead – Bake potatoes in advance, then reheat and top with sauce just before serving

Freeze tip – Not recommended, as the sauce may separate

FAQs

Can I use pre-shredded cheese?
It’s best to use freshly grated cheese—pre-shredded may not melt smoothly.

Can I use frozen broccoli?
Yes, thaw it first and chop finely before adding to the sauce.

Are these potatoes spicy?
Mildly! The cayenne adds gentle heat, which can be adjusted or omitted.

Can I make this vegan?
Yes, use plant-based milk, vegan butter, and vegan cheese.

Replace broccoli cheese sauce with your favorite vegan version.

How do I make the skins extra crispy?
Bake the potatoes directly on the oven rack or rub with oil and salt before baking.

What’s the best cheese for this recipe?
Medium or sharp cheddar melts beautifully and adds bold flavor, but you can get creative!
